A conceptual design of a space station power system based on a Brayton cycle and solar powered has been developed. A key component of such a system is the thermal energy storage module, which is of crucial importance during periods of darkness. We have developed a computer program-FPAK1.F, simulating one possible storage design. We describe the code and using it, raise some questions about the system under study.
